How to solve this Bond Book-Value Interest question
Setup
Setup
Measure the bond immediately after the sixth coupon. Four coupons and the redemption payment remain, and the yield per coupon period is 6%.
Model
Model
The prospective book value is the present value of those four coupons plus redemption. Interest earned during the next book-value period is the yield rate multiplied by that opening book value.
Compute
Compute
The prospective value is 10,693.0. Multiplication by 0.06 gives 641.58 of book-value interest, which rounds to 642.
Answer
Answer
The calculation gives 642 for bond book-value interest, matching published choice B.
